Abstract
We are seeking to find measures of risk that can be used by management and the developers. We will show which characteristics and constraints could be assessed directly from the requirements specification document in the form of numeric values. These numeric must be normalised and used in a comparative manner with other events in the software development process. The required characteristics — the specific risks — will be expressed by the proposed metrics. The construction of a database with requirements analysis process data is emphasised as a testbed for metrics evaluation. In summary our approach is as follows: First decide what the important areas of risk are, then identify attributes available in a CASE (Computer Aided Software engineering) repository that may give an insight into these risks and then combine these attributes to provide risk measures.
